7.11 KEYLOCK

The KEYLOCK function enables the user to lock the buttons on the flash unit to

prevent them from inadvertently being pressed. When the KEYLOCK function is

activated, a symbol

appears on the display above the two middle but-

tons.

Deactivating the Key-Lock function

When a button is pressed, „UNLOCK Press

these keys“ is displayed . A corresponding

symbol

is displayed to indicate that

the buttons are locked. To deactivate the

Key-Lock function, press both middle but-

tons for about 3 seconds. The display is reset to its normal state when the

Key–Lock function is deactivated.

7.12 AF-BEAM (AF auxiliary light)

If the AF metering system of a digital AF reflex camera is unable to focus due to
insufficient ambient lighting, the camera activates the AF auxiliary light built
into the flash unit. This projects a stripe pattern onto the subject which the
camera uses to focus.
The “AF BEAM” function can be specifically turned off in the select menu of the
flash unit.
